summaryrefslogtreecommitdiff
path: root/source
diff options
context:
space:
mode:
authorHubert Figuiere <hub@figuiere.net>2008-12-24 13:42:15 -0500
committerHubert Figuiere <hub@figuiere.net>2008-12-24 13:42:15 -0500
commitcfa248512b31613d019700df3e1ce5cad6915a34 (patch)
tree1b9265a481c4f90129495ed2c08b6bdffc9d94e6 /source
parentcb64b5b4c224825f761ca14e23d6fc72dfe0c136 (diff)
* source/XMPFiles/FileHandlers/P2_Handler.cpp (SetStartTimecodeFromLegacyXML):
Don't compare string pointers.
Diffstat (limited to 'source')
-rw-r--r--source/XMPFiles/FileHandlers/P2_Handler.cpp6
1 files changed, 3 insertions, 3 deletions
diff --git a/source/XMPFiles/FileHandlers/P2_Handler.cpp b/source/XMPFiles/FileHandlers/P2_Handler.cpp
index d8cd2cd..064942c 100644
--- a/source/XMPFiles/FileHandlers/P2_Handler.cpp
+++ b/source/XMPFiles/FileHandlers/P2_Handler.cpp
@@ -679,11 +679,11 @@ void P2_MetaHandler::SetStartTimecodeFromLegacyXML ( XML_NodePtr legacyVideoCont
dmTimeFormat = "50Timecode";
- } else if ( p2FrameRate == "59.94p" ) {
+ } else if ( ( p2FrameRate == "59.94p" ) && ( p2DropFrameFlag != 0 ) ) {
- if ( p2DropFrameFlag == "true" ) {
+ if ( std::strcmp ( p2DropFrameFlag, "true" ) == 0 ) {
dmTimeFormat = "5994DropTimecode";
- } else if ( p2DropFrameFlag == "false" ) {
+ } else if ( std::strcmp ( p2DropFrameFlag, "false") == 0 ) {
dmTimeFormat = "5994NonDropTimecode";
}